Severstal retains the second place in the West and is not ready to give up in the fight for leadership in the conference. Andrey Kozyrev's team has earned 70 points in 52 matches and has slightly lost ground from Dynamo Minsk, but so far they cannot reach the Locomotive. The hosts are in good shape and have lost only once in regular time in the second half of January. At the end of the last away series, they lost to CSKA (2:4), but then beat Torpedo (3:2, OT) and turned out to be stronger than Dynamo Moscow (3:2).
The Lynxes started the match rather poorly in the Russian capital and were two goals behind by the first break. In the second 20 minutes, they got down to business and, thanks to the efforts of Alexander Skorenov and Adam Lishka, they were able to equalize the score. In the third segment, Ilya Ivantsov became the author of the most important goal, which eventually became the winner. The steelworkers hardly threw, but they managed not to miss.
Ruslan Abrosimov retains his leadership in the club's goalscoring list. At the moment, he has 43 points (21+22) in the goal+pass system.

Spartak has been at the bottom of the conference table for a long time, but now the Muscovites have managed to climb to sixth place in the West. The capital's team has 60 points in its piggy bank after 50 games and has an excellent opportunity to become the leader of the pursuit group of the top four. Alexey Zhamnov's team have gained excellent form and lost only five points in January. The Red and white played well in the home series and after losing to Lokomotiv (2:3, OT) confidently dealt with Lada (6:2) and SKA (4:0).
In the game against the army team, Andrei Mironov's squad quickly seized the game advantage and took the lead. Daniil Gutik scored in the majority in the first period, and in the second 20 minutes Pavel Ordin scored too much. A couple of minutes later, the same Daniil Gutik scored again in unequal formations, and Nikita Korostelev put the final point at the very end of the match.
Adam Ruzicka remains the club's top scorer. He scored 40 points (16+24) in the goal+pass system.
